Rice Noodles: A Culinary Journey Through Vietnam - Unveiling Authentic Flavors and Timeless Traditions
The aroma of simmering broth, the vibrant colors of fresh herbs, the delicate dance of chopsticks against porcelain – these are just a few sensory experiences that encapsulate Vietnamese cuisine. And within this tapestry of culinary delights, rice noodles, or bún, stand as a versatile canvas upon which chefs weave their gastronomic magic. “Rice Noodles: A Culinary Journey Through Vietnam” by Nguyen Thi Phuong Anh is not merely a cookbook but an artistic exploration of these ubiquitous strands and the rich culture they embody.
Nguyen Thi Phuong Anh, a renowned culinary anthropologist and author, has meticulously curated this tome, inviting readers to delve into the heart and soul of Vietnamese cooking. Her prose flows like the Mekong River itself, effortlessly weaving together historical anecdotes, cultural insights, and mouthwatering recipes.
The book’s structure mirrors a journey through Vietnam, starting with the northern regions famed for their rich broths and complex noodle soups. Imagine yourself perched on a rickety stool overlooking a bustling Hanoi street, inhaling the fragrant steam emanating from a bowl of bún chả, grilled pork patties served atop a bed of vermicelli noodles. Anh’s detailed instructions and insightful commentary transport you directly to this scene, enabling you to recreate the dish in your own kitchen.
Moving southwards, the book unveils the lighter flavors and refreshing elements characteristic of central Vietnam. Picture yourself strolling through the ancient city of Hue, captivated by the vibrant colors of bún bò Huế, a spicy beef noodle soup bursting with lemongrass, chili, and shrimp paste. Anh demystifies the intricate balancing act of sour, sweet, salty, and spicy that defines this iconic dish, empowering readers to achieve culinary harmony in their own bowls.
Finally, the journey culminates in the southern regions, where coconut milk reigns supreme and flavors are infused with tropical vibrancy. Envision yourself relaxing on a sun-drenched beach in Ho Chi Minh City, indulging in a plate of bún riêu cua, a tangy crab and tomato noodle soup that epitomizes southern comfort food. Anh’s expert guidance unveils the secrets to creating this luscious broth, coaxing out its unique depth and complexity.
Beyond Recipes: A Tapestry of Culture and History
“Rice Noodles: A Culinary Journey Through Vietnam” transcends the boundaries of a mere cookbook. Woven throughout the recipes are captivating stories that shed light on the history, traditions, and cultural nuances surrounding Vietnamese cuisine.
-
The Significance of Rice Noodles: Anh delves into the origins of rice noodles in Vietnam, tracing their evolution from humble beginnings to their current status as a national staple. Readers will discover fascinating anecdotes about the noodle-making process, from the meticulous selection of rice grains to the intricate art of hand-rolling and drying the strands.
-
Regional Variations: The book celebrates the diversity of Vietnamese cuisine by highlighting regional variations in noodle dishes. From the hearty broths of Hanoi to the spicy flavors of Saigon, Anh paints a vivid picture of how geographical influences shape culinary traditions.
-
Cultural Significance: Beyond their gastronomic appeal, rice noodles hold a deep cultural significance in Vietnam. They are often served during festivals and celebrations, symbolizing prosperity, longevity, and unity. Anh explores these cultural associations, providing readers with a richer understanding of the role that food plays in Vietnamese society.
